Best time to fly to Melbourne

Melbourne experiences a mild, temperate climate throughout the year. Summers (December to February) are warm, with average temperatures ranging from 15°C to 30°C. Winters (June to August) are cool, with average temperatures between 5°C and 15°C. Spring (September to November) and autumn (March to May) offer pleasant temperatures, making them ideal for exploring the city.

Melbourne airports

Melbourne has two main airports that are currently operating and serving commercial flights: Melbourne Airport and Avalon Airport.

Melbourne Airport

Melbourne Airport is the primary airport serving Melbourne. It's a large, modern facility with multiple terminals, handling both domestic and international flights from a multitude of airlines. It is easily accessible by various methods.

To reach the city centre from Melbourne Airport, you can use public transport, such as the SkyBus or train services. Taxis and ride-sharing services are also readily available. You can also hire a car for greater flexibility.

Avalon Airport

Avalon Airport is a smaller airport located southwest of Melbourne. Primarily used for domestic flights and low-cost carriers. While further from the city centre, transport options including bus services and taxis are available.
